Peugeot key fobs and remote keys use an unique immobiliser mechanism to prevent them from being copied. They rely on a small chip of glass incorporated into the key to connect with the immobiliser of the vehicle. The chip has a unique code that cannot be altered or removed, and it will only allow the car to start when it receives the proper signal from the key. If the chip is not correctly placed the car will not start. It also cuts off the fuel supply.

The immobilisers installed by Peugeot's factory have been upgraded since 1995 to guarantee the safety of your vehicle. Each key has a tiny glass chip hidden inside the head. It's programmed with a unique code which cannot be erased or overwritten. The chip is linked to the Peugeot immobiliser, and the system will only allow the engine to start only when it receives the right signal.

Peugeot 308 Replacement key car keys are equipped with a transponder chips that works in sync with the immobiliser of the vehicle. The chip is concealed in the head of the manual or remote key, and when inserted into a lock barrel it transmits an encoded code. The immobiliser will check if the code matches, and then permits the engine to start. Fuel supply will be cut if the chip is missing or has an unrelated code.
